How similar are DFEM and VPL?
Dimensional Emerging Markets Core Equity 2 ETF (DFEM, by Dimensional) holds 6579 positions; Vanguard Pacific Stock Index Fund (VPL, by Vanguard) holds 2334. They have 375 holdings in common, and by portfolio weight the two funds are 13.6% identical. In practical terms the pair is lightly overlapping, with most of each portfolio distinct.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much do DFEM and VPL overlap?
DFEM and VPL overlap by 13.6% of portfolio weight. They share 375 holdings (DFEM holds 6579 positions and VPL holds 2334), based on each fund's latest SEC-reported holdings.
Is it redundant to own both DFEM and VPL?
The two portfolios are 13.6% identical by weight. Owning both is not redundant. Most of each portfolio is distinct, so the funds can serve different roles.
What are the biggest shared holdings of DFEM and VPL?
The largest positions held by both funds are 005930, 000660, 005380, 009150 and 034020. Together the top 10 shared positions account for 64% of the total overlap.
What does DFEM own that VPL doesn't?
6204 positions (83.6% of DFEM) are unique to DFEM, led by TSMWF, 700 and 9988. In the other direction, 1959 positions (79.8% of VPL) are unique to VPL.
